Configuring Network Settings Manually
If you disable DHCP on your phone, you need to configure the following network
settings manually:
•
IP Address
•
Subnet Mask
•
Gateway
•
Primary DNS
•
Secondary DNS
You can configure the network settings using the configuration files, the IP phone
UI, or the Aastra Web UI.
Note:
If you disable DHCP on the phone, the phone uses the TFTP
protocol as the default server protocol. If you want to specify a different
